Old friend, Andie Miller, published an interview with South African writer Phaswane Mpe in the Mail and Guardian. Mpe, who died this past year at age 34, is one of South Africa’s most promising and most interesting post-aparheid writers. Andie and Mpe focus on his life as a reader and the surprising books that he says helped change his life.
